Step-by-step explanation:
![(-14,1)(13,-2)](https://tex.z-dn.net/?f=%28-14%2C1%29%2813%2C-2%29)
Use the slope-intercept formula:
![y=mx+b](https://tex.z-dn.net/?f=y%3Dmx%2Bb)
m is the slope and b is the y-intercept. Use the slope formula first:
![\frac{y_{2}-y_{1}}{x_{2}-x_{1}} =\frac{rise}{run}](https://tex.z-dn.net/?f=%5Cfrac%7By_%7B2%7D-y_%7B1%7D%7D%7Bx_%7B2%7D-x_%7B1%7D%7D%20%3D%5Cfrac%7Brise%7D%7Brun%7D)
Rise over run is the change in the y-axis over the change in the x-axis. Plug in the coordinates:
![(-14(x_{1}),1(y_{1}))\\(13(x_{2}),-2(y_{2}))](https://tex.z-dn.net/?f=%28-14%28x_%7B1%7D%29%2C1%28y_%7B1%7D%29%29%5C%5C%2813%28x_%7B2%7D%29%2C-2%28y_%7B2%7D%29%29)
![\frac{-2-1}{13-(-14)}](https://tex.z-dn.net/?f=%5Cfrac%7B-2-1%7D%7B13-%28-14%29%7D)
Simplify parentheses (two negatives makes a positive):
![\frac{-2-1}{13+14}](https://tex.z-dn.net/?f=%5Cfrac%7B-2-1%7D%7B13%2B14%7D)
Simplify:
![\frac{-3}{27} =-\frac{3}{27}=-\frac{1}{9}](https://tex.z-dn.net/?f=%5Cfrac%7B-3%7D%7B27%7D%20%3D-%5Cfrac%7B3%7D%7B27%7D%3D-%5Cfrac%7B1%7D%7B9%7D)
The slope is
. Insert into the equation:
![y=-\frac{1}{9}x +b](https://tex.z-dn.net/?f=y%3D-%5Cfrac%7B1%7D%7B9%7Dx%20%2Bb)
Now, to find the y-intercept, take one of the points and substitute for the x and y values of the equation:
![(13,-2)\\-2=-\frac{1}{9} (13)+b](https://tex.z-dn.net/?f=%2813%2C-2%29%5C%5C-2%3D-%5Cfrac%7B1%7D%7B9%7D%20%2813%29%2Bb)
Solve for b, the y-intercept. Simplify parentheses:
![-\frac{1}{9}*\frac{13}{1}=-\frac{13}{9}](https://tex.z-dn.net/?f=-%5Cfrac%7B1%7D%7B9%7D%2A%5Cfrac%7B13%7D%7B1%7D%3D-%5Cfrac%7B13%7D%7B9%7D)
![-2=-\frac{13}{9} +b](https://tex.z-dn.net/?f=-2%3D-%5Cfrac%7B13%7D%7B9%7D%20%2Bb)
Add
to both sides:
![-2+\frac{13}{9}=-\frac{13}{9} +\frac{13}{9} +b\\\\-2+\frac{13}{9} =b](https://tex.z-dn.net/?f=-2%2B%5Cfrac%7B13%7D%7B9%7D%3D-%5Cfrac%7B13%7D%7B9%7D%20%2B%5Cfrac%7B13%7D%7B9%7D%20%20%2Bb%5C%5C%5C%5C-2%2B%5Cfrac%7B13%7D%7B9%7D%20%3Db)
Simplify:
![-\frac{2}{1} +\frac{13}{9}\\\\-\frac{18}{9}+\frac{13}{9}\\ \\b=-\frac{5}{9}](https://tex.z-dn.net/?f=-%5Cfrac%7B2%7D%7B1%7D%20%2B%5Cfrac%7B13%7D%7B9%7D%5C%5C%5C%5C-%5Cfrac%7B18%7D%7B9%7D%2B%5Cfrac%7B13%7D%7B9%7D%5C%5C%20%20%5C%5Cb%3D-%5Cfrac%7B5%7D%7B9%7D)
The y-intercept is
. Insert this into the equation:
![y=-\frac{1}{9} x-\frac{5}{9}](https://tex.z-dn.net/?f=y%3D-%5Cfrac%7B1%7D%7B9%7D%20x-%5Cfrac%7B5%7D%7B9%7D)
